one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way online where a lengthy URL can be transformed into a shorter, more manageable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the initial very long UR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the advent of social networking platforms like Twitter, wherever character limitations for posts created it tricky to share extended URLs.

Beyond social networking, URL shorteners are useful in marketing strategies, e-mails, and printed media where extensive UR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Elements of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ener usually contains the next factors:

Website Interface: This is actually the entrance-close aspect where by buyers can enter their very long URLs and get shortened variations. It might be a straightforward variety over a web page.
Database: A database is critical to retailer the mapping involving the original very long URL and also the sh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that takes the quick URL and redirects the person into the corresponding extensive URL. This logic will likely be executed in the world wide web server or an application lay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ners present an API to ensure 3rd-get together program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original extended URLs.
three.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ief one. Several methods is often utilized, such as:

Hashing: The extensive URL may be hashed into a fixed-measurement string, which serves as being the shorter UR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(distinctive URLs resulting in the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A person frequent technique is to make use of Base62 encoding (which employs sixty two figures: 0-9,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ry during the databases. This technique makes certain that the shorter URL is as shorter as you can.
Random String Technology: Another tactic would be to produce a random string of a hard and fast duration (e.g., six figures) and Examine if it’s previously in use while in the database. If not, it’s assigned to the long URL.
four. Database Administration
The databases schema for any URL shortener is frequently simple, with two primary fields:

ID: A singular identifier for each URL entry.
Extended URL: The original URL that needs to be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The shorter Model in the URL, usually stored as a novel string.
Together with these, you may want to store metadata including the creation day, expiration date, and the number of situations the limited URL continues to be acc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is a important Portion of the URL shortener's Procedure. Whenever a person clicks on a short URL, the company has to rapidly retrieve the first URL from your databases and redirect the user working with an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be approximately inst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) might be used to speed up the retrieval approach.

six. Security Issues
Stability is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ener is usually ab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-social gathering safety products and services to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Prevention: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ers endeavoring to produce A huge number of limited URLs.
seven.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might have to take care of a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ic throughout various servers to manage subst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that may sc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ate issues like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into different services to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ners typically give anal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, the place the site visitors is coming from, along with other helpful metrics. This requires logging Each individual red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
